Dental Hygienist applicants have rated the interview process at Tend with 2.7 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 67% positive. To compare, the company-average is 66.7%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Dental Hygienist roles take an average of 14 days to get hired, when considering 3 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Tend overall takes an average of 11 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Tend as a Dental Hygienist according to 3 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 40%
Skills test: 20%
Personality test: 20%
One on one interview: 20%

There was a 2 step process. There was an initial call with a recruiter to go over the job description and reviewed my resume. After, there was a second Zoom call with clinical questions and scenarios presented.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
How would you redirect a doctor to a possible needed treatment after an exam is complete and the issue was not addressed?

I reached out to the recruiter via email to express my interest in working at Tend. The recruiter responded promptly and conducted a phone interview, providing more details about the position, available resources, and benefits. Following this, I participated in a two-day working interview at one of their local offices, where I had the opportunity to meet the office manager and staff. During this time, we discussed availability and potential opportunities within the role. I am happy to share that I have accepted the offer.
